The Evolution of Android: How Jelly Bean Set the Standard

Jelly Bean, released as Android 4.1 in 2012, introduced a multitude of features that not only enhanced user experience but also laid down a benchmark for subsequent Android iterations. It was during this release that Google emphasized smoothness and responsiveness, coining the term **Project Butter**. This project aimed to make Android’s interface buttery smooth by improving the frame rate and touch responsiveness, revolutionizing how users interacted with their devices.

One of the most notable features was Google Now, which set the foundation for AI-based assistants. Users could receive personalized information based on their preferences and location, ushering in a new era of contextual awareness in mobile applications. Additionally, Jelly Bean brought about a more **accessible and intuitive notifications center**, allowing users to manage notifications swiftly and efficiently, making multitasking seamless and enhancing overall user engagement.

Furthermore, Jelly Bean introduced support for **multiple user accounts** on tablets, which was a significant leap for family-oriented devices. This feature catered to different user needs while maintaining privacy, showcasing Android’s adaptability in a shared environment. As we compare Jelly Bean with its predecessors and successors, it’s clear that the innovations it introduced have become essential components of the Android experience today.

The Impact of Project Butter on Smoothness and Speed

The introduction of Project Butter in Jelly Bean OS marked a significant leap forward in the overall user experience of Android devices. Designed to enhance the performance of the OS, this initiative focused on making animations smoother and interactions more fluid. As a result, users experienced visually appealing transitions and a notable reduction in lag, which was particularly evident in tasks such as launching applications or scrolling through menus.

Key improvements resulting from Project Butter include:

  • 60 FPS Rendering: The OS now maintained a consistent 60 frames per second, ensuring that animations felt responsive and lively.
  • Touch Responsiveness: Enhanced touch sensitivity reduced the delay between user input and on-screen response, creating a more natural interaction.
  • Jank Reduction: Developers were equipped with tools to identify and mitigate “jank,” or stuttering, during animations, leading to a smoother overall experience.

In essence, the transformative impact of Project Butter can be summed up in how it changed the perception of Android performance. Users found their devices more enjoyable to use, which translated into higher satisfaction levels and greater adoption rates of Jelly Bean. The foundation laid by Project Butter effectively set a benchmark for all subsequent Android versions, reflecting a commitment to delivering quality in both speed and smoothness.

Q&A: Jelly Bean OS – Why It’s Still the Sweetest Android Update Ever

Q: What is Jelly Bean OS?

A: Jelly Bean OS refers to Android versions 4.1 to 4.3, released by Google from 2012 to 2013. This update brought several upgrades to the Android platform, enhancing performance, user experience, and overall device capabilities. It’s often remembered fondly for its unique features and improvements over its predecessor, ICS (Ice Cream Sandwich).

Q: What are the standout features of Jelly Bean?

A: One of the most celebrated features of Jelly Bean is Project Butter, which dramatically improved the user interface’s responsiveness and fluidity. The updated notifications system allows users to interact with notifications directly from the pull-down menu, which was a game-changer at the time. Voice search and Google Now were also introduced, making information retrieval more intuitive and personalized.

Q: How did Jelly Bean improve performance?

A: Jelly Bean focused on optimizing the processing speed and efficiency of the Android operating system. With Project Butter, the update aimed to achieve a smooth 60 frames per second for animations and transitions. This meant that users experienced less lag and a superior overall performance compared to previous versions.
